Launch of SpainSat NG-1: A Milestone in Secure Communication

On January 29, at 8:34 PM EST, SpaceX successfully launched a new communications satellite named SpainSat Next Generation 1 (SpainSat NG-1) into orbit. The launch took place from Launch Complex 39A at NASA’s Kennedy Space Center in Florida, using a Falcon 9 rocket. This satellite is designed to cater to the secure communication needs of governmental agencies, highlighting advancements in technology and reliability in satellite operations.

Overview of the Launch

The Falcon 9 rocket deployed the SpainSat NG-1 into a geostationary transfer orbit, a crucial point in space that allows satellites to maintain a fixed position relative to the Earth. It was significant to note that this mission was the final flight for the rocket’s first-stage booster, designated B1073. This booster had an impressive track record, having completed 20 previous missions. Unfortunately, due to the specifics of this mission, SpaceX decided not to recover the booster after launch.

The SpainSat NG-1 was successfully deployed about 31.5 minutes after the rocket lifted off, marking another successful milestone for SpaceX.

Advanced Features of SpainSat NG-1

SpainSat NG-1 is a joint project created by Hisdesat, a Spanish company, in collaboration with the European Space Agency (ESA). It stands out for its focus on providing secure communication capabilities, particularly for government use. Here are some of the key features that make SpainSat NG-1 unique:

  • Advanced Antenna Technology: The satellite comes equipped with sophisticated antennas that strengthen secure data transmission and communication effectiveness.
  • Precise Beam Steering: This technology allows for targeted coverage, meaning the satellite can focus its communications where they are most needed.
  • Enhanced Security and Flexibility: The satellite is designed to adapt to the varying needs of governmental users across Europe and beyond, ensuring a reliable and safe communication network.

SpainSat NG-1 represents a significant leap in securing satellite communication services in Europe, addressing essential needs for current and future governmental operations.

Falcon 9 Booster B1073: A Legacy of Success

The Falcon 9 rocket’s first-stage booster, B1073, has had an impressive history throughout its operational life. With its final flight during the launch of SpainSat NG-1, it completed a total of 21 missions. Some notable missions undertaken by Booster B1073 include:

  • HAKUTO-R M1: An important lunar lander mission that aimed to explore the Moon’s surface.
  • CRS-27: A cargo resupply mission directed at the International Space Station, showcasing its versatility in supporting human spaceflight.

Given its successful track record, it is understandable that SpaceX decided not to recover the booster for this mission, prioritizing mission performance over booster recovery.

The Satellite’s Path to Operational Service

Upon deployment into a geostationary transfer orbit, SpainSat NG-1 began its journey toward its final operational position located approximately 35,786 kilometers above Earth. The satellite will utilize its onboard propulsion system to maneuver into the designated orbital slot.

Once it reaches this final position, the satellite will undergo a series of system checks to ensure everything is functioning correctly. After successfully completing these checks, SpainSat NG-1 will commence its operational services, providing robust communication solutions to governmental users.
